Abstract

Senior high school chemistry laboratory teaching often relies on uniform procedures that do not adequately respond to learner differences, while many blended-learning practices remain at the level of resource addition rather than instructional integration. Focusing on two representative quantitative experiments - solution preparation and acid-base titration - this paper develops a three-dimensional framework through literature analysis, curriculum interpretation, and framework-to-case mapping. The framework integrates tiered resource construction, differentiated inquiry task design, and a process-oriented assessment loop. The analysis suggests that the framework is aligned with curriculum standards, compatible with the disciplinary logic of quantitative experiments, and feasible under ordinary school conditions. Rather than claiming completed large-scale effectiveness verification, the study offers a cautious and transferable design reference for subsequent classroom implementation and empirical testing.
